Responsible Gambling Tools and Resources
This aspect is crucial for all players, regardless of experience. Beginner-friendly casinos go above and beyond in providing tools for responsible gambling, such as deposit limits, loss limits, session limits, self-exclusion options, and easy access to support organizations. For players in Denmark, adherence to local regulations and the provision of resources like ROFUS (Register Over Frivilligt Udelukkede Spillere) are essential. A casino that actively promotes and facilitates responsible play demonstrates a genuine concern for its users’ well-being.

Licensing and Regulation
Perhaps the most fundamental aspect, yet often overlooked by beginners, is proper licensing. For players in Denmark, a license from the Danish Gambling Authority (Spillemyndigheden) is non-negotiable. This ensures that the casino operates under strict regulatory oversight, adheres to fair play standards, and protects player funds. While experienced players instinctively check for this, a beginner-friendly casino will prominently display its licensing information, instilling confidence from the outset.
